An elite law firm in Greater Boston is seeking an experienced Estate Administrator. The successful candidate will oversee the administration of estates, including high net worth matters, while managing diverse responsibilities like drafting legal documents and preparing probate filings.

Extensive experience in estate administration, especially in a law firm or trustee context, is essential. The role offers a competitive salary and various benefits, including medical insurance and a pension plan.
